2DMVRe Triplex Basic Operations

2.1 Principal Operating Modes

The DVMRe Triplex has three principal modes of operation:

Live Viewing.

Playback.

Recording.

All three of these modes can operate simultaneously. Each mode is discussed in detail later in this section.

1.Multiscreen Selection Buttons: 16, 10, 7, and 4 way.

2.Monitor Selection Button: Monitor A or Monitor B.

3.Multiscreen Selection Buttons: 13, 9, 6 way, and Picture-in-Picture.

4.Camera Selection Number buttons: Camera numbers 1 through 16.

5.Reverse Play Button: Playback in Reverse.

6.Freeze Button: Freezes camera images on-screen in Live mode. Pauses Playback.

7.Play Forward Button: Begins Playback.

8.Jog/Shuttle: Controls Playback speed and Menu selections.

9.Menu Button: Provides access to on-screen menus.

10.Power Indicator: Indicates power on/off condition.

11.Alarm button: Allows user to acknowledge and silence alarms.

12.Sequence Button: Sequences camera views.

13.Zoom Button: Provides a 2X digital zoom.

14.Function Button: Used in conjunction with Camera Buttons to run Macros.

15.Record Button: Used to Start and Stop Recording.

16.Stop Button: To stop Playback and return to Live mode.

17.Search Button: Access to stored video data.

18.Enter Button: Confirms selection in menus.
